黑狐家游戏

数据库概念结构设计的重要性和设计步骤,数据库概念结构设计的关键工具及其重要性解析

欧气 0 0

本文目录导读:

  1. 数据库概念结构设计的重要性
  2. 数据库概念结构设计的主要工具类型
  3. 数据库概念结构设计步骤

数据库概念结构设计是数据库设计中至关重要的一环,它决定了数据库系统的整体架构和性能,在数据库设计过程中,概念结构设计的主要任务是确定实体、属性、关系等基本概念,为后续的数据库逻辑设计和物理设计提供基础,本文将探讨数据库概念结构设计的主要工具类型,并分析其重要性和设计步骤。

数据库概念结构设计的重要性

1、确保数据库系统的高效性:概念结构设计是数据库设计的起点,它直接影响数据库的性能,合理的设计能够减少数据冗余、提高查询效率,降低数据库系统的维护成本。

2、便于理解和维护:概念结构设计使得数据库系统的结构更加清晰,便于用户和开发人员理解数据库的设计意图,降低维护难度。

数据库概念结构设计的重要性和设计步骤,数据库概念结构设计的关键工具及其重要性解析

图片来源于网络,如有侵权联系删除

3、促进数据库系统的可扩展性:在概念结构设计阶段,充分考虑了系统的扩展性,为后续的数据库扩展提供了便利。

4、保障数据一致性:概念结构设计有助于规范数据结构,降低数据不一致性,提高数据质量。

数据库概念结构设计的主要工具类型

1、E-R图(实体-联系图):E-R图是数据库概念结构设计中最常用的工具之一,它通过实体、属性、关系的图形化表示,直观地展示数据库的结构,E-R图具有以下特点:

(1)简洁明了:E-R图以图形化的方式展示数据库结构,易于理解和沟通。

(2)易于修改:E-R图可以方便地添加、删除和修改实体、属性、关系。

(3)支持多种数据库设计方法:E-R图可以应用于多种数据库设计方法,如层次模型、关系模型、网络模型等。

2、UML类图:UML(统一建模语言)类图是面向对象设计的一种图形化表示方法,它通过类、属性、方法等元素展示系统的结构,UML类图在数据库概念结构设计中的应用如下:

(1)支持面向对象设计:UML类图适用于面向对象数据库设计,有利于提高数据库系统的可扩展性和可维护性。

数据库概念结构设计的重要性和设计步骤,数据库概念结构设计的关键工具及其重要性解析

图片来源于网络,如有侵权联系删除

(2)便于与其他设计工具集成:UML类图可以与其他设计工具(如Rational Rose、Visual Paradigm等)集成,提高设计效率。

3、数据流图(DFD):数据流图是展示系统数据流动过程的一种图形化工具,它通过数据流、处理过程、数据存储等元素展示系统的结构,DFD在数据库概念结构设计中的应用如下:

(1)分析业务流程:DFD有助于分析业务流程,为数据库设计提供依据。

(2)识别数据需求:DFD可以识别系统中的数据需求,为数据库设计提供参考。

数据库概念结构设计步骤

1、需求分析:了解业务需求,明确数据库系统需要解决的问题。

2、实体识别:根据需求分析,确定系统中的实体。

3、属性识别:为每个实体确定属性,描述实体的特征。

4、关系识别:分析实体之间的关系,确定关系的类型。

数据库概念结构设计的重要性和设计步骤,数据库概念结构设计的关键工具及其重要性解析

图片来源于网络,如有侵权联系删除

5、E-R图绘制:根据实体、属性、关系,绘制E-R图。

6、优化E-R图:对E-R图进行优化,提高数据库性能。

7、验证E-R图:验证E-R图的正确性和完整性。

8、生成数据库逻辑设计:根据E-R图,生成数据库逻辑设计。

数据库概念结构设计是数据库设计中至关重要的一环,其工具类型包括E-R图、UML类图和DFD等,合理运用这些工具,可以确保数据库系统的性能、可扩展性和可维护性,本文从重要性、工具类型和设计步骤等方面对数据库概念结构设计进行了探讨,希望能为数据库设计人员提供参考。

标签: #数据库设计中的概念结构设计的主要工具是什么类型

黑狐家游戏
  • 评论列表

留言评论